  "textContent": "The nacelle has a lip prolonged by an interior pipe forming an air intake. A front frame delimits an annular duct (40) in which hot air circulates, and a panel treats sound from an outer side toward an inner side of an acoustically resistive layer. A pipe (98) is provided with an opening (100), which emerges into the annular duct such that the hot air is conveyed to the panel. The opening guides the hot air according to a referred direction (102), which forms an angle (beta) lower than 60 degree with a flow direction (42) of the hot air in the annular duct.",
